Just in case some of you that cast would want a mold such as what made the bullets yotehunter has been sending, mihec is making another run of these molds over on castboolits.
http://www.castboolits.gunloads.com/...ad.php?t=97566 Still plenty of time to get in on it. It WILL be next year though, he's swamped with mold orders. You would have to register and then post on that thread to reserve one. It's a 4 cav, can be had in .452 and .454 with round tapered HP and pentagonal HP pins. I'm not sure,but I believe the pins turned around backwards results in no HP, just a flat point. Quote:

When you've hoarded lead the was some of us have, shooting comes down to the cost of a primer and a little powder. With my 40S&W that's about $0.04 a shot. Pretty tough to argue with those prices and the results I get wouldn't make me even think about factory ammo or bullets in the thing unless I just needed the brass and they already had the factory junk stuffed in the end. My HP cast bullets perform better than any factory HP I've tried---double win on that one.
